Key for Batter vs. Pitcher Grids on the next pageKey for Batter vs. Pitcher Grids Below

Batter vs. Pitcher totals are career totals. All others are year-to-date.

PA - Plate Appearances (AB+BB+HBP+SH+SF+CI)
BF - Batters Faced
BA - Batting Average
OBP - On-Base Percentage
SLG - Slugging Percentage
Last 28d - PA and OPS in the last 28 days.
SB/CS - Stolen Bases and Caught Stealing
HR/E - Home Runs and Errors Made
ERA-K/9 - Earned Run Average and SO per 9 IP
Total - Team totals for those categories.
Usage - See the note below the grid.
OPS - On-Base Percentage + Slugging Percentage (a good single number for measuring a player's hitting, avg. is .750 or so)
RA/G & RS/G - Runs scored and allowed per game.
PA/vRH - Plate Appearances overall/PA's vs. Right-handed Pitchers
Catcher Def. - Catcher Defense with each catcher's Stolen Bases, Caught Stealings, and Passed Balls allowed.
G/S/vB or G/S/vP - Links to the player's 2014 gamelogs, splits, or career batter vs. pitcher results
vLH/vRH - OPS vs. left-handed pitchers and vs. right-handed pitchers
Hm or Rd, Home or Road - OPS or OPS allowed in home or road games.
OF G: LF / CF / RF - A - Outfielders with the games played by position and their total number of assists
vs LHB - Batters faced and OPS allowed against left-handed batters
vs RHB - Batters faced and OPS allowed against right-handed batters
HR/SB/CS - Pitcher's Home Runs, Stolen Bases and Caught Stealings allowed
MLB Best, Middle, Worst

Usage -- each character represents the number of pitches thrown by the pitcher for yesterday, two days ago, three days ago, ...., up to eight days ago:
· - did not pitch; o - less than 16 pitches; X - at least 16 pitches (the median relief outing)
An Example ( ·X···o·X ): Yesterday off, 16 or more pitches, three days off, less than 16 pitches, day off, 16 or more pitches (8 days ago). Yesterday is in bold for improved scanning.
